LED calculator
2024-08-21 | By M5Stack
License: General Public License Bluetooth / BLE LED / Display Drivers Wifi Arduino ESP32 M5Stack
Thanks for the source code and project information provided by @Framework Labs
Things used in this project
Los pedidos se entregan normalmente a España en un plazo de 48 horas, según la ubicación.
El envío gratuito a España se aplica a pedidos de 50 EUR o más. Los gastos de envío serán de 18 EUR para todos los pedidos inferiores a 50 EUR.
Flete prepago de UPS o FedEx: DDP (aranceles y aduanas pagados por DigiKey)
Flete prepago de DHL: CPT (aranceles, aduanas e IVA adeudados en el momento de la entrega)
Cuenta de crédito para instituciones y empresas calificadas
Pago por adelantado a través de transferencia bancaria
![]()
![]()
![]()
![]()


Más productos de socios totalmente autorizados
Tiempo promedio de envío de 1 a 3 días , se pueden aplicar cargos adicionales por envío. Consulte la página de productos, el carrito y el pago para estimar la velocidad del envío actual.
Incoterms: CPT (impuestos, tarifas aduaneras e IVA/impuestos aplicables pagaderos en el momento de la entrega)
Para obtener más información, visite Ayuda y soporte
License: General Public License Bluetooth / BLE LED / Display Drivers Wifi Arduino ESP32 M5Stack
Thanks for the source code and project information provided by @Framework Labs
Things used in this project
About
This implements a little calculator with 7 LEDs as output (applying a shift register), an M5Stack-Atom-Lite as the MCU and its button as input.
Usage
Select the first number by cycling through digits 0 to 9, minus-sign "-" and decimal point "." by short press. To enter another digit double-press. To finish the number and get to the operator selection apply a long press.
Cycle through the operators plus, minus, multiply and divide with a short press and leave to the input of the second operand with a long press. Enter the second operand like the first one.
If you then long press to finish the number, the result will be displayed.
Example
In the example video you can see the input of the operand "3" followed by the selection of the multiply operator ("x") followed by the selection of digit "5" as the second operand. The result 15 is displayed as "=15".
Obtenga respuestas rápidas y precisas de los técnicos e ingenieros experimentados de DigiKey en TechForum.
Visite el área de Ayuda de asistencia del sitio web para buscar información obre pedido, envío, entrega y más.
Los usuarios registrados pueden realizar un seguimiento de sus pedidos a través del menú desplegable de la cuenta o haciendo clic aquí. *El estado del pedido puede demorar 12 horas para que se actualice después de solicitar el pedido inicial.
Los usuarios pueden comenzar el proceso de devolución en nuestra Página de devoluciones.
Los usuarios registrados pueden crear cotizaciones en myLists.
Visite la Página de registro e ingrese la información solicitada. Recibirá una confirmación por correo electrónico cuando se haya completado el registro.
Los pedidos se entregan normalmente a España en un plazo de 48 horas, según la ubicación.
El envío gratuito a España se aplica a pedidos de 50 EUR o más. Los gastos de envío serán de 18 EUR para todos los pedidos inferiores a 50 EUR.
Flete prepago de UPS o FedEx: DDP (aranceles y aduanas pagados por DigiKey)
Flete prepago de DHL: CPT (aranceles, aduanas e IVA adeudados en el momento de la entrega)
Cuenta de crédito para instituciones y empresas calificadas
Pago por adelantado a través de transferencia bancaria
![]()
![]()
![]()
![]()


Más productos de socios totalmente autorizados
Tiempo promedio de envío de 1 a 3 días , se pueden aplicar cargos adicionales por envío. Consulte la página de productos, el carrito y el pago para estimar la velocidad del envío actual.
Incoterms: CPT (impuestos, tarifas aduaneras e IVA/impuestos aplicables pagaderos en el momento de la entrega)
Para obtener más información, visite Ayuda y soporte
¡Gracias!
¡Esté atento a las noticias y actualizaciones de DigiKey que llegarán a su bandeja de entrada!
Ingrese una dirección de correo electrónico
Acepte marcando la casilla